Inspirisys Solutions Reports 43% Revenue Surge in Q2 FY26, Profit Doubles
Inspirisys Solutions Limited reported strong Q2 FY2026 results with consolidated revenue of ₹12,185.00 lakhs, up 43% YoY. Profit after tax nearly doubled to ₹740.00 lakhs. Services segment was the largest revenue contributor. EPS improved to ₹1.85 from ₹0.95. The company completed liquidation of two wholly-owned subsidiaries in UAE and Japan, and closed its Singapore branch operations in June 2025.

Inspirisys Solutions Limited , a leading IT services provider, has reported a robust financial performance for the second quarter of fiscal year 2026, with significant growth in both revenue and profitability.
Strong Revenue Growth
For the quarter ended September 30, 2025, Inspirisys Solutions recorded consolidated revenue of ₹12,185.00 lakhs, marking a substantial 43% increase from ₹8,531.00 lakhs in the same quarter of the previous year. This impressive growth demonstrates the company's strong market position and effective business strategies.
Profit Surge
The company's bottom line showed even more impressive growth, with consolidated profit after tax rising to ₹740.00 lakhs, nearly doubling from ₹377.00 lakhs year-over-year. This significant increase in profitability indicates improved operational efficiency and cost management.
Half-Year Performance
For the six-month period, Inspirisys Solutions reported consolidated revenue of ₹20,840.00 lakhs, compared to ₹17,162.00 lakhs in the previous year, showing consistent growth over a longer timeframe.
Segment-wise Performance
Inspirisys Solutions operates through three business segments, each contributing to the overall growth:
| Segment | Revenue (₹ in lakhs) |
|---|---|
| Systems Integration | 3,799.00 |
| Services | 8,009.00 |
| Warranty Management Services | 163.00 |
The Services segment emerged as the largest contributor to the company's revenue, highlighting its strength in IT infrastructure management and software development.
Earnings Per Share
The company's earnings per share for continuing operations stood at ₹1.85 for the quarter, a significant improvement from ₹0.95 in the previous year, reflecting the growth in profitability.
Corporate Actions
The Board of Directors approved the unaudited financial results for the quarter. Additionally, the company completed the liquidation of two wholly-owned subsidiaries:
- Inspirisys Solutions DMCC in UAE
- Inspirisys Solutions Japan Kabushiki Kaisha
Furthermore, Inspirisys Solutions closed its Singapore branch operations in June 2025, streamlining its international presence.
